Supporting daily energy and stamina isn't about extreme interventions — it's about a handful of habits, repeated consistently. Here are eight worth building.
1. Lift Something Heavy
Resistance training two or three times a week helps preserve muscle, which is metabolically active tissue that keeps energy expenditure and stamina up as you age.
2. Protect Seven to Nine Hours of Sleep
Recovery, hormone regulation and next-day energy all depend on consistent, adequate sleep.
3. Move Throughout the Day
Regular movement supports circulation more than one intense session followed by hours of sitting.
4. Eat Enough Protein
Protein supports muscle maintenance and provides steadier energy than carbohydrate-heavy meals that spike and crash.
5. Stay Hydrated
Even mild dehydration measurably reduces energy and physical performance.
6. Manage Stress Deliberately
Chronic stress is a genuine energy drain. Adaptogens like Rhodiola support the body's response, but daily stress-management habits matter just as much.
7. Limit Alcohol
Alcohol disrupts sleep quality even when it doesn't feel like it, undermining next-day energy.
